Restructure the persistence layer from horizontal "models/ + repositories/"
split into vertical entity-aligned directories. Each entity (thread_meta,
run, feedback) now owns its ORM model, abstract interface (where applicable),
and concrete implementations under a single directory with an aggregating
__init__.py for one-line imports.

Layout:
  persistence/thread_meta/{base,model,sql,memory}.py
  persistence/run/{model,sql}.py
  persistence/feedback/{model,sql}.py

models/__init__.py is kept as a facade so Alembic autogenerate continues to
discover all ORM tables via Base.metadata. RunEventRow remains under
models/run_event.py because its storage implementation lives in
runtime/events/store/db.py and has no matching repository directory.

The repositories/ directory is removed entirely. All call sites in
gateway/deps.py and tests are updated to import from the new entity
packages, e.g.:

    from deerflow.persistence.thread_meta import ThreadMetaRepository
    from deerflow.persistence.run import RunRepository
    from deerflow.persistence.feedback import FeedbackRepository

Full test suite passes (1690 passed, 14 skipped).

"""Tests for ThreadMetaRepository (SQLAlchemy-backed)."""
import pytest
from deerflow.persistence.thread_meta import ThreadMetaRepository
async def _make_repo(tmp_path):
from deerflow.persistence.engine import get_session_factory, init_engine
url = f"sqlite+aiosqlite:///{tmp_path / 'test.db'}"
await init_engine("sqlite", url=url, sqlite_dir=str(tmp_path))
return ThreadMetaRepository(get_session_factory())
async def _cleanup():
from deerflow.persistence.engine import close_engine
await close_engine()
class TestThreadMetaRepository:
@pytest.mark.anyio
async def test_create_and_get(self, tmp_path):
repo = await _make_repo(tmp_path)
record = await repo.create("t1")
assert record["thread_id"] == "t1"
assert record["status"] == "idle"
assert "created_at" in record
fetched = await repo.get("t1")
assert fetched is not None
assert fetched["thread_id"] == "t1"
await _cleanup()
@pytest.mark.anyio
async def test_create_with_assistant_id(self, tmp_path):
repo = await _make_repo(tmp_path)
record = await repo.create("t1", assistant_id="agent1")
assert record["assistant_id"] == "agent1"
await _cleanup()
@pytest.mark.anyio
async def test_create_with_owner_and_display_name(self, tmp_path):
repo = await _make_repo(tmp_path)
record = await repo.create("t1", owner_id="user1", display_name="My Thread")
assert record["owner_id"] == "user1"
assert record["display_name"] == "My Thread"
await _cleanup()
@pytest.mark.anyio
async def test_create_with_metadata(self, tmp_path):
repo = await _make_repo(tmp_path)
record = await repo.create("t1", metadata={"key": "value"})
assert record["metadata"] == {"key": "value"}
await _cleanup()
@pytest.mark.anyio
async def test_get_nonexistent(self, tmp_path):
repo = await _make_repo(tmp_path)
assert await repo.get("nonexistent") is None
await _cleanup()
@pytest.mark.anyio
async def test_list_by_owner(self, tmp_path):
repo = await _make_repo(tmp_path)
await repo.create("t1", owner_id="user1")
await repo.create("t2", owner_id="user1")
await repo.create("t3", owner_id="user2")
results = await repo.list_by_owner("user1")
assert len(results) == 2
assert all(r["owner_id"] == "user1" for r in results)
await _cleanup()
@pytest.mark.anyio
async def test_list_by_owner_with_limit_and_offset(self, tmp_path):
repo = await _make_repo(tmp_path)
for i in range(5):
await repo.create(f"t{i}", owner_id="user1")
results = await repo.list_by_owner("user1", limit=2, offset=1)
assert len(results) == 2
await _cleanup()
@pytest.mark.anyio
async def test_check_access_no_record_allows(self, tmp_path):
repo = await _make_repo(tmp_path)
assert await repo.check_access("unknown", "user1") is True
await _cleanup()
@pytest.mark.anyio
async def test_check_access_owner_matches(self, tmp_path):
repo = await _make_repo(tmp_path)
await repo.create("t1", owner_id="user1")
assert await repo.check_access("t1", "user1") is True
await _cleanup()
@pytest.mark.anyio
async def test_check_access_owner_mismatch(self, tmp_path):
repo = await _make_repo(tmp_path)
await repo.create("t1", owner_id="user1")
assert await repo.check_access("t1", "user2") is False
await _cleanup()
@pytest.mark.anyio
async def test_check_access_no_owner_allows_all(self, tmp_path):
repo = await _make_repo(tmp_path)
await repo.create("t1") # owner_id=None
assert await repo.check_access("t1", "anyone") is True
await _cleanup()
@pytest.mark.anyio
async def test_update_status(self, tmp_path):
repo = await _make_repo(tmp_path)
await repo.create("t1")
await repo.update_status("t1", "busy")
record = await repo.get("t1")
assert record["status"] == "busy"
await _cleanup()
@pytest.mark.anyio
async def test_delete(self, tmp_path):
repo = await _make_repo(tmp_path)
await repo.create("t1")
await repo.delete("t1")
assert await repo.get("t1") is None
await _cleanup()
@pytest.mark.anyio
async def test_delete_nonexistent_is_noop(self, tmp_path):
repo = await _make_repo(tmp_path)
await repo.delete("nonexistent") # should not raise
await _cleanup()
